空间网架焊接空心球节点承载力研究

摘    要:对焊接空心球节点,采用ANSYS9.0程序进行了承载力的模拟分析计算,获得了球节点受拉压时壳面弹塑性应力和变形分布规律,定出了破坏带区域在球壳中的确切位置.根据焊接空心球节点的受拉失效机理,提出了球节点塑性失效破坏的三维应力状态分析模型.进而研究了球体-焊缝-钢管一体复杂应力状态下的极限受力分析.应用极限状态计算理论得到焊接空心球节点抗拉承载力计算公式.基于空心球节点受压破坏机理的探讨和试验数据的统计分析,以若干变参数的线性回归方法,获得球节点受压承载力计算公式.数据结果表明,所得空心球节点承载力公式计算值与试验值拟合精度较好.

关 键 词:焊接空心球  有限元分析  承载力  破坏机理

Study on Bearing Capacity of Welded Hollow Sphere in Space Truss

Abstract:In this paper,the welded hollow sphere joint was analyzed by using of commercial code ANSYS 9.0.The elastoplastic stress and distortion distributions on sphere surface of the joint under tension and compression were obtained.The collapse zone position in the sphere shell was located.According to the collapse mechanism of the joint in tension,a new elastoplastic analysis model in the three-D state of stress was proposed.Further study on the static ultimate analysis of hollow sphere-welding seams-steel tube in their entirety was presented,and the bearing capacity formula of the hollow sphere in tension was derived using the limit state theory.Based on a discussion about the collapse mechanism of the hollow sphere under compression and on the statistical analysis of the experimental data,the bearing capacity formulas of the sphere joint were established with the linear regression method.The results show that the formulas agree well with the test.
Keywords:welded hollow sphere  FEM analysis  bearing capacity  collapse mechanism
